picnicking

[ˈpɪk.nɪk.ɪŋ]

picnicking Definition

the activity of having a picnic, especially regularly or as a social event.

Summary: picnicking in Brief

'Picnicking' [ˈpɪk.nɪk.ɪŋ] refers to the activity of having a picnic, often done regularly or as a social event. It involves outdoor meals, such as sandwiches and drinks, and can include items like a picnic basket, picnic table, and picnic blanket. 'Picnicking' is a popular summer activity for families and companies may organize picnicking events for their employees.
